Waterfalls around Reichelsheim (Odenwald) are found within the Geo-Naturpark Bergstraße-Odenwald, a region characterized by its diverse natural landscapes and geological formations. The area offers a variety of natural water features, particularly noticeable during wetter seasons. While not known for grand, powerful waterfalls, the region provides opportunities to explore seasonal water flows and tranquil natural settings. These natural attractions are often integrated into hiking trails, allowing visitors to experience the Odenwald's broader natural beauty.

The best time to experience the waterfalls around Reichelsheim (Odenwald) is during wetter seasons, particularly after periods of rain or in spring. This is when features like the Fallbach Waterfall are most likely to gush with water. Many smaller streams and cascades also become more prominent during these times.
Yes, several water features in the region are family-friendly. The Fallbach Waterfall, Mossy stream near Rodenstein, and Weschnitz riverbed are all noted as suitable for families. The Weschnitz riverbed, in particular, has a small waterfall feature that can be a nice spot for children to play.
Yes, the Weschnitz riverbed is specifically highlighted as a dog-friendly spot. It's perfect for letting your dog cool off on warm days. Generally, the natural trails in the Geo-Naturpark Bergstraße-Odenwald are welcoming to dogs, but always keep them on a leash and respect local regulations.
After rainfall, the waterfalls and streams in the Reichelsheim (Odenwald) area are at their most impressive. The Fallbach Waterfall is known to gush significantly, and smaller features like the Mossy stream near Rodenstein will have more visible cascades. During the summer months, especially after dry periods, many of the waterfalls and smaller water features in Reichelsheim (Odenwald) can significantly diminish or even dry up. The Fallbach Waterfall is known to dry up in summer, and the Waldwasserwand Waterfall may only be a thin trickle. Timing your visit to coincide with wetter seasons is key for seeing them at their best.
Yes, at Berndsbrunnen, you'll find a waterfall with clear water that is suitable for a short rest and for refilling your water bottles. This spot provides a convenient amenity for hikers exploring the area.

Near the Weschnitz riverbed, you can find an old hydroelectric power plant in Weschnitzmühl, which offers a glimpse into the region's industrial past. Additionally, the Berndsbrunnen fountain commemorates the last Olfen pig shepherd, adding a touch of local history to your visit.
